2021 InnovateFPGA Contest: Creatieve ontwerpers tonen ons hoe we duurzaamheid kunnen aanpakken
Bijgedragen door De Noord-Amerikaanse redacteurs van DigiKey
2021-12-16
Ik weet niet hoe het met u zit, maar ik maak me steeds meer zorgen over onze collectieve toekomst. We horen de term "duurzaamheid" tegenwoordig vaak, maar wat betekent het eigenlijk? Welnu, één manier om het te bekijken is dat duurzaamheid verwijst naar het vermogen van de mens en de biosfeer van de aarde om naast elkaar te bestaan. In Our Common Future, ook bekend als het Brundtland-rapport, dat in oktober 1987 door de Verenigde Naties werd gepubliceerd, werd duurzaamheid enigszins treffend gedefinieerd als "...voldoen aan de behoeften van de huidige generatie zonder het vermogen van toekomstige generaties om in hun behoeften te voorzien in gevaar te brengen"
Ons vermogen om duurzaamheid te bereiken wordt op de proef gesteld door bevolkingsgroei en inefficiënt gebruik van de beschikbare hulpbronnen. Daarom is het thema van de InnovateFPGA Design Contest 2021-22, diedoor Terasic in samenwerking met Intel, Analog Devices Inc. (ADI) en Microsoft - is "Connecting the Edge for a Sustainable Future (Applying Technology to Address Global Challenges)"
Het doel van de wedstrijd is te inspireren en duurzame oplossingen te creëren die onze milieu-impact verminderen. Laten we eens kijken naar enkele van de ideeën: ze zullen u zeker aan het denken zetten over wat u kunt doen.
De strijd tussen bevolking en middelen
Een van de dingen die duurzaamheid negatief beïnvloeden, is het aantal mensen op de planeet. Neem bijvoorbeeld de beroemde piramiden van Gizeh, die werden gebouwd van ongeveer 2550 tot 2490 v. Chr. Dat is slechts ongeveer 4.500 jaar geleden, nu ik deze woorden schrijf. In die dagen van weleer, waren er maar ongeveer 20 miljoen mensen op de planeet. Ter vergelijking: op het moment van dit schrijven zijn we met naar schatting 7,9 miljard mensen, en de voorspelling is dat dit aantal zal stijgen tot 8,5 miljard in 20301 , 9,2 miljard in 20402, en bijna 10 miljard in 20503.
Positief is dat een van de dingen die duurzaamheid positief kunnen beïnvloeden, ons vermogen is om sociale en technologische oplossingen voor onze problemen te bedenken en toe te passen.
Ik hou van science fiction en science fantasy. Als jonge knaap aan het eind van de jaren zestig en het begin van de jaren zeventig herinner ik mij het lezen van de sciencefictionroman The Rolling Stones uit 1952 (ook gepubliceerd onder de naam Space Family Stone in het Verenigd Koninkrijk) van de Amerikaanse sciencefictionschrijver, luchtvaartingenieur en marineofficier Robert Anson Heinlein. In dit verhaal koopt de familie Stone, die bewoners van de maan zijn, een gebruikt ruimteschip en bouwen het om, waarna ze een rondreis door het zonnestelsel maken. Als onderdeel hiervan bezoeken zij de asteroïdengordel waar het equivalent van de California Gold Rush (1848-1855) aan de gang is, met asteroïdenmijnwerkers die naar verschillende materialen zoeken, waaronder radioactieve ertsen.
Hoewel dit voor veel mensen nog steeds sciencefiction lijkt, is het interessant om op te merken dat de Colorado School of Mines in 2017 een multidisciplinair afstudeerprogramma heeft gelanceerd met een post-baccalaureaatcertificaat, master of science,en doctoraat graden in asteroïde-mijnbouw (ze noemen het 'Space Resources', maar ze houden niemand voor de gek - we weten wat ze bedoelen).
Het probleem is dat de aarde een gesloten systeem is. Er is een beperkte hoeveelheid materiaal beschikbaar. Wat we vandaag hebben, is wat we morgen en overmorgen zullen hebben. Hoewel er serieus wordt gesproken over het delven van grondstoffen (b.v. ijzer, nikkel, iridium, palladium, platina, goud, magnesium, en - mogelijk - water) van de maan, van objecten in de buurt van de aarde en van asteroïden, zal het nog minstens 20 jaar duren voordat dit daadwerkelijk zal gebeuren. Zelfs wanneer het zover komt, zullen de kosten in termen van energie, tijd en hulpbronnen om deze materialen naar de aarde terug te brengen, betekenen dat de hoeveelheden ervan nog vele jaren minuscuul zullen zijn in het geheel der dingen. Het komt erop neer dat wij in de afzienbare toekomst geen grote hoeveelheden extra grondstoffen kunnen verwachten, zodat wij zo goed mogelijk gebruik moeten maken van wat wij hebben.
Het tij keren: de InnovateFPGA Design Contest 2021-22
Geïnspireerd door de problemen en behoeften die zijn vastgesteld door organisaties als het Global Environment Facility (GEF) Small Grants Program, dat wordt uitgevoerd door het Ontwikkelingsfonds van de Verenigde Naties (UNDF), leidt dit alles ons naar de InnovateFPGA Design Contest (Afbeelding 1).
Afbeelding 1: Een van de dingen die duurzaamheid positief kunnen beïnvloeden, is ons vermogen om sociale en technologische oplossingen voor onze problemen te bedenken en toe te passen. (Bron afbeelding: DigiKey)
Terasic, Intel, ADI en Microsoft zijn de uitdaging van duurzaamheid aangegaan en hebben de huidige InnovateFPGA Design Contest 2021-22 gelanceerd, die de nadruk legt op het intelligente gebruik van FPGA's aan de rand van de wereld om de vraag naar hulpbronnen te verminderen.
FPGA's zijn bijzonder nuttig voor deze toepassing omdat zij zowel flexibel als herconfigureerbaar zijn. Ook zijn veel van de ontwerpen in deze wedstrijd gebaseerd op het gebruik van geavanceerde algoritmen, zoals kunstmatige intelligentie (AI) en machine vision (MV), waarvoor enorme hoeveelheden rekenkracht nodig zijn. De programmeerbare structuur van een FPGA kan worden geconfigureerd om bewerkingen op massaal parallelle wijze uit te voeren, waardoor zij rekenintensieve algoritmen lokaal en in real time kunnen uitvoeren terwijl zij relatief weinig stroom verbruiken.
De deelnemers werden uitgenodigd zich in te schrijven als teams bestaande uit één tot drie personen die zich in hetzelfde geografische gebied bevinden. Deze teams werden uitgenodigd om gebruik te maken van een P0685 DE10-Nano FPGA Cloud Connectivity Kit van Terasic, die is gebaseerd op de combinatie van de uiterst populaire P0496 DE10-Nano Kit en een P0499 RFS-dochterkaart (Afbeelding 2).
De DE10 Nano is gebaseerd op een Intel Cyclone V SE FPGA, aangevuld met 1 gigabyte (Gbyte) DDR3 SDRAM, een Arduino-uitbreidingsheader (Uno R3-compatibel), full HD HDMI-uitgang, UART-naar-USB, een USB On-the-Go (OTG)-poort, een Micro SD-kaartaansluiting, Gigabit Ethernet en GPIO-kopjes. De Cyclone V system-on-chip (SoC) FPGA beschikt over de combinatie van programmeerbare fabric (110.000 logic elements (LE's)) en dubbele 32-bit Arm® Cortex®-A9-processorkernen.
Afbeelding 2: De FPGA Cloud Connectivity Kit combineert de rijke functies en veelzijdigheid van een Intel Cyclone V SoC FPGA met de voordelen van cloudconnectiviteit. Extra sensoren kunnen worden aangesloten door middel van de Arduino-compatibele headers of de ADI QuikEval Header. (Bron afbeelding: Terasic)
Ondertussen voegt de RFS dochterkaart Wi-Fi en Bluetooth communicatie toe, evenals een breed scala aan sensoren zoals een negen-assige versnellingsmeter, gyroscoop, en magnetometer, samen met omgevingslicht, temperatuur, en vochtigheidssensoren.
Natuurlijk is de DE10-Nano FPGA Cloud Connectivity Kit, hoe krachtig deze ook is, op zichzelf slechts van beperkt nut. "Niemand is een eiland", zoals de beroemde Engelse dichter John Donne in de 17e eeuw schreef, waarmee hij bedoelde dat niemand echt zelfvoorzienend is, en dat iedereen afhankelijk is van het gezelschap en het comfort van anderen om te kunnen gedijen. In dit geval kan het nodig zijn de DE10-Nano FPGA Cloud Connectivity Kit uit te breiden met extra sensoren; ook kan het nodig zijn te communiceren met de cloud.
Om de InnovateFPGA Design Contest 2021-22 te ondersteunen, worden deze kits gratis ter beschikking gesteld van geselecteerde deelnemende teams, samen met een kleine hoeveelheid insteekkaarten van Analog Devices, en kredieten/gelimiteerde toegang tot Microsofts Azure Cloud Services.
Analog Devices heeft een uitgebreide portfolio van evaluatiekaarten en referentieontwerpen om de uitdagingen van ontwikkelaars op systeemniveau te helpen oplossen. Voorbeelden zijn de EVAL-CN0398-ARDZ (bodemvocht-, pH- en temperatuurmeting), de EVAL-CN0397-ARDZ (driekanaals lichtdetectie voor slimme landbouw), en de DC1338B (I²C temperatuur-, stroom-, en spanningsmonitor). Deze kaarten kunnen op de DE10 Nano worden aangesloten via de Arduino-compatibele headers of de ADI QuikEval Header.
De vorm van duurzaamheid: Een greep uit de 261 projectinzendingen
Natuurlijk kon ik het niet laten een wandeling te maken door de rijkdom van de ingediende projecten. Het gaat om 261 projecten die een enorme verscheidenheid aan toepassingsgebieden bestrijken, dus als u besluit zelf een kijkje te nemen, kunt u zich beter voorzien van iets te drinken en een snack, want u zult geruime tijd met plezier bezig zijn.
Herstel van koraalriffen en geautomatiseerde vuilnisophaling: Voorbeeldprojecten die onmiddellijk mijn aandacht trokken waren EM043, waarin een onderwater intelligent microbieel leveringssysteem met diepgaande leerprocessen wordt voorgesteld voor het herstel van de habitat van koraalriffen (figuur 3), en AS034, een slimme vuilnisbak die in staat zal zijn voorwerpen te identificeren en te classificeren om te bepalen wat wel en wat niet kan worden gerecycleerd.
Afbeelding 3: Project EM043 is een systeem voor het herstel van de habitat van koraalriffen dat koraalprobiotica kan toedienen en de doeltreffendheid ervan kan controleren. De levering zal nauwkeurig worden geregeld door een deep learning netwerk dat de kleurveranderingen van de koralen in de gaten houdt. (Bron afbeelding: InnovateFPGA)
Project EM043 is erop gericht het verbleken van koraalriffen tegen te gaan dat wordt veroorzaakt door temperatuursveranderingen die tot gevolg hebben dat de riffen de in hun weefsels levende algen verdrijven. De algen zorgen niet alleen voor de kleur, maar stellen het koraal ook in staat de fotosynthese uit te voeren die nodig is om het in leven te houden en het ecosysteem in stand te houden.
Er zijn verschillende nuttige micro-organismen voor koralen (BMC's) die het verblekingsproces kunnen vertragen of zelfs stopzetten, maar welke dat zijn en de juiste mix moeten worden bepaald door langdurige prototypering en tests aan de rand. Project EM043 combineert de Cloud Connectivity Kit met een mobiele 4G router, een zonnepaneel, een camera, een temperatuursensor, een niveausensor, en deep-learning algoritmen om de analyse uit te voeren, en regelt de BMC-levering met behulp van een gespecialiseerde module (figuur 4).
Afbeelding 4: Project EM043 combineert deep-learning analyse met sensoren, zonne-energie, een 4G-router en een BMC-leveringsmechanisme, met de DE10 als het centrale verwerkingsplatform. (Bron afbeelding: InnovateFPGA)
De Microsoft Azure-cloud is verbonden via de 4G-router, en om het leveringssysteem op afstand te bedienen en de toestand van het koraal visueel te controleren.
Het voorgestelde systeem maakt het mogelijk voor mariene onderzoekers om nauwkeurige en betrouwbare monitoringexperimenten uit te voeren over de doeltreffendheid van BMC's bij het verminderen van het verblekingseffect, en zo bij te dragen tot een belangrijk effect op het herstel van een ecosysteem van koraalriffen.
Organische CO2-verwijdering: Een ander project dat ik waardeer vanwege zijn eenvoud en schaalbaarheid is EM003. Het gaat om een bijzondere kamerplant, de gebedsplant (maranta leuconeura), een laaggroeiende tropische plant die oorspronkelijk uit Zuid-Amerika komt. Verschillende studies en experimenten hebben aangetoond dat deze plant zeer efficiënt broeikasgassen kan absorberen in vergelijking met soortgelijke kamerplanten. De ontwerpers van het project merken op dat slechts één van deze planten de hoeveelheid CO2 in één kamer met 14,40% kan doen dalen over een periode van 24 uur.
Het idee achter dit project is om gebedsplanten te dwingen een zo groot mogelijke hoeveelheid CO2 op te nemen. Dit zal worden bereikt door sensorische gegevens (temperatuur, vochtigheid, omgevingslicht, bodemvochtigheid) in de wolk te registreren, met de irrigatiecyclus te experimenteren, en de resultaten te analyseren. Het uiteindelijke doel is miljoenen mensen deze planten te laten gebruiken en gegevens van zo veel mogelijk mensen te verzamelen en te analyseren. Naast de DE10-Nano FPGA Cloud Connectivity Kit wordt in dit project gebruik gemaakt van een bodemvochtsensor en een waterpomp met een DC-actuator (Afbeelding 5).
Afbeelding 5: In project EM003 worden alle zintuiglijke gegevens voorbewerkt door de FPGA, die ook de irrigatiecyclus van de plant controleert; de verwerkte gegevens worden vervolgens naar de cloud gestuurd om te worden gecombineerd met gegevens van andere planten en te worden geanalyseerd. (Bron afbeelding: (InnovateFPGA)
Drone voor analyse van waterstress in de landbouw: Ik weet niet hoe het met u zit, maar ik heb een zwak voor alles wat met drones te maken heeft, dus een ander project dat om onderzoek vroeg was AP008, met een drone die "Agri-Bird" wordt genoemd en die helpt bij het opsporen van waterstress in landbouwomgevingen (Afbeelding 6). Dit team is gevestigd in Islamabad, Pakistan.
Volgens het team gebruikt de landbouw ongeveer 90% van de watervoorraad van Pakistan. Als de huidige trend doorzet, kunnen de watervoorraden van het land tegen 2040 uitgeput zijn. Om dit te vermijden en oplossingen aan te reiken voor de gemiddelde landbouwer, stelt project AP008 voor de combinatie van meteorologische gegevens, gegevens van sensoren op de grond en door een drone verzamelde gegevens vanuit de lucht te gebruiken om een voorspellingsmodel voor waterstress op te stellen.
Afbeelding 6: Door gegevens van een drone te combineren met gegevens van andere bronnen, kan het resulterende waterstressmodel worden gebruikt om a) verlies van producten door watertekort, b) verlies van bodemvoedingsstoffen door overmatige besproeiing, c) slechte regeling van irrigatie, en d) natuurbranden te voorkomen. (Bron afbeelding: InnovateFPGA)
Het wegwerken van plastic afval: Ik zou nog wel even door kunnen gaan, maar een laatste project dat mij persoonlijk interesseert is AP080, waarbij een kleine slimme robot door de straten van de stad reist om plastic afval te zoeken en te verzamelen voor recycling. Dit is echt een schot in de roos omdat ik tegenwoordig overal waar ik kom plastic afval zie (Afbeelding 7).
Afbeelding 7: Zo hoeft het niet te gaan als project AP080 zijn slimme robot tot leven wekt. Hoewel dit project in eerste instantie gericht is op straten in de stad, kan het - of andere soortgelijke projecten - uiteindelijk de plaag van het plastic afval verlichten. (Bron foto: The Nature Conservatory)
Toen ik klein was en mijn ouders me mee op vakantie namen, was het onze familieregel om na een dag op het strand alles schoner achter te laten dan we het aantroffen. Dit hield in dat we niet alleen ons eigen zwerfvuil verzamelden, maar ook al het andere afval dat we in de buurt zagen. Ik krijg de kriebels als ik mensen achteloos afval zie weggooien door het te laten vallen terwijl ze lopen of door het uit het raam van hun auto te gooien. Het zal moeilijk zijn om dat soort mensen te overtuigen om te stoppen, maar hun gedrag zou worden afgezwakt als we robots hadden zoals die welke in dit project worden voorgesteld, die achter hen opruimen.
Het angstaanjagende is dat, hoe interessant en divers de hier gepresenteerde voorbeeldprojecten ook zijn, we nog niet eens de oppervlakte hebben bereikt van alle mogelijkheden die de inzendingen voor deze wedstrijd bieden. Alleen al bij het doorbladeren van de projecten op hoog niveau riep ik voortdurend "Ooh, Shiny!", en pauzeerde ik om er dieper in te duiken. Ik ga zelfs nog een keer zwemmen zodra ik klaar ben met deze column.
Conclusie
Alle inzendingen voor de InnovateFPGA Design Contest 2021-22 zijn binnen. De teams werken nu koortsachtig aan hun projecten en hebben hun zinnen gezet op de regionale finales, die in maart 2022 zullen plaatsvinden, en de grote finale, die in juni 2022 zal worden gehouden. Ik weet niet hoe het met u zit, maar ik kan in ieder geval niet wachten om de resultaten te zien van deze actuele en tot nadenken stemmende uitdaging.
Disclaimer: The opinions, beliefs, and viewpoints expressed by the various authors and/or forum participants on this website do not necessarily reflect the opinions, beliefs, and viewpoints of DigiKey or official policies of DigiKey.




